Information Technology Reference
In-Depth Information
ÆEV_CommunityContractÇ
Phone Repair
Enterprise Object Types
Roles
ÆEV_ObjectiveOfÇ
User Handset
Logistics Provider
Loan Handset
Customer
Handset
Phone Supplier
ÆEV_CommunityÇ
Phone Repair
ÆEV_ObjectiveÇ
Phone Repair Objective
PhoneMob system
Bank
User
Organization
e-Document
Phone Repair Provider
Paper Document
HQ system
Person
Branch staff
Document
Company
Branch system
HQ staff
Manufacturer
ÆEV_ObjectiveÇ
description = "Take the hassle out of
mobile phone support to customers"
PhoneMob
Policies
Billing Policy
Phone Loan Policy
ÆEV_ProcessÇ
Phone Repair Community Behaviour
FIGURE A.3: Community contract for the Phone Repair community.
A.1.2
Community Roles and Object Types
The roles of the communities have already been described in detail in
the chapter 2. For example, figure 2.2 showed the roles of the Phone Repair
community, which are summarized here within figure A.3. The roles for the
other communities are named in the Roles package included in the community
contracts (shown in figures A.4 and A.5).
Enterprise object types are described in their corresponding packages. For
example, figure A.6 shows the object types defined in the Phone Repair commu-
nity. Assignment policies constraining which enterprise objects can fill which
roles in the communities were shown in figures 2.5 and 2.6.
ÆEV_CommunityContractÇ
CustomerOrg
ÆEV_ObjectiveOfÇ
Enterprise Objects Types
Roles
Person
Employee
ÆEV_CommunityÇ
CustomerOrg
ÆEV_ObjectiveÇ
CustomerOrg Objective
Document
Manager
Contract Manager
Phone User
Handset
Policies
Bill
Repair Request Policy
ÆEV_ObjectiveÇ
description = "To become the most
agile company in providing services."
Temporary Phone Request Policy
ÆEV_ProcessÇ
CustomerOrg Community Behaviour
FIGURE A.4: Community contract for the CustomerOrg community.
 
Search WWH ::




Custom Search